About This Game
Core Gameplay Loop
Melody Motion Challenge places you in control of a cheerful character who moves to the music. Your task is to tap or click at the right moments to keep the performance smooth. Each successful action adds to your score, while a missed beat causes a brief stumble. There is no penalty for mistakes, so you can try again immediately. The game uses a simple one-button control scheme, making it accessible on both desktop computers and mobile devices. The challenge comes from the increasing speed and complexity of the patterns, which require sharper timing as you advance.

Progression and Difficulty
Melody Motion Challenge includes multiple stages that gradually increase in difficulty. Early levels use slower tempos and simple patterns, allowing you to learn the basics. Later stages introduce faster beats and more intricate sequences. The game does not punish failure, so you can replay any level as many times as you like. This design supports gradual skill building without frustration. The difficulty curve is steady, ensuring that each new level feels like a natural step forward.
Accessibility and Platform
This game runs directly in your web browser, requiring no downloads or installations. It works on both Windows and Mac computers using a mouse, and on tablets or phones via touch input. The interface is minimal, with no complex menus or settings. This makes it easy for players of all ages to start playing immediately.
